UTLEIEBOLIG INVEST AS is registered as a limited company in Oslo, Oslo with organisation number 928556697. The business is classified under rental and operating of own or leased real estate (NACE 68.200). The company was incorporated in 2021. Registered share capital is NOK 30,000, divided into 100 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Utleie av fast eiendom.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2025 financial year, show NOK 1.0m in revenue and NOK 603,000 in operating profit.
